Understanding the Kel-Tec PMR-30 Recall

The Kel-Tec PMR-30 recall wasn't a single event, but rather a series of actions taken by Kel-Tec to address reported malfunctions and potential safety hazards. These issues primarily revolved around failures within the firearm's firing mechanism. Specifically, the recall targeted potential issues with the firing pin and its interaction with the cartridge.

Key Issues Leading to the Recall

  • Firing Pin Problems: Reports surfaced of firing pins breaking or failing to function correctly, leading to misfires or dangerous malfunctions. This was a significant concern, as a malfunctioning firing pin could cause the gun to fail to fire when needed, or worse, to fire unexpectedly.

  • Magazine Issues: While not the primary focus of the recall, some reports also indicated issues with magazine reliability. These issues contributed to the overall concern regarding the firearm's safety and functionality.

  • Safety Concerns: The combination of potential firing pin failures and magazine issues created a significant safety risk for users. These problems weren't isolated incidents; enough reports emerged to warrant a comprehensive recall by the manufacturer.

What to Do if You Own a Kel-Tec PMR-30

If you own a Kel-Tec PMR-30, it's crucial to take the following steps:

  1. Check Kel-Tec's Website: Visit Kel-Tec's official website for the most up-to-date information regarding the PMR-30 recall. Their site should provide clear instructions on determining if your firearm is affected.

  2. Identify Your Serial Number: Locate the serial number on your firearm. This number is crucial for determining if your specific pistol is subject to the recall.

  3. Contact Kel-Tec: If your serial number falls within the affected range, contact Kel-Tec directly to arrange for the necessary repairs or replacement parts. Be prepared to provide your serial number and other relevant information.

  4. Safe Storage: Until you've had your firearm inspected and any necessary repairs made, store it unloaded and in a safe location, away from children and unauthorized individuals.

  5. Follow Instructions: Follow all instructions provided by Kel-Tec precisely. This is critical for ensuring the safety and proper functioning of your firearm.
